These are wonderful bowls for a LOT of things -- not just pasta.
I have two sets of these. They used to be made in the US. They no longer are. It's a bit disappointing, but they've closed up the factory that made Chirp and it was our main dish pattern, so we'll likely have to transition to something else over time. But they do seem to still be making a few in other countries. Like this pasta bowl. Now, apart from a slight tint in the paint colour, they're identical to the ones made in the US. Same quality. Same look. I wouldn't hesitate to buy them as replacements. They are a great size. Larger than a chirp salad plate. Slightly smaller than the dinner plates. They hold a lot of pasta. But they also hold... well... everything. And they're not very deep, which means they stand upright nicely in the dishwasher (yes, they're dishwashable and microwaveable). I use them for temporary bowls while cooking, bone bowls, salad bowls... whenever I need a larger bowl, these are a great go-to, because I can then just stick them in the dishwasher, and they stack right next to the plates without taking up extra space. I can fit a LOT of these in the dishwasher (I don't HAVE a lot of them, but I COULD). They're fantastic as general purpose bowls if only just for this reason. But also, they're fine china -- bone china, so they're incredibly durable (don't drop them on the ground, but they're going to last a good while). The glaze on them is beautifully done, and the motif is cheerful and fun. Overall, it's a great product. I'd take a star away because they stopped making the other Chirp dinnerware -- heck, I'd take away ALL the stars if I thought I could convince them to start making it again. But that wouldn't be fair to the bowl.
